The Yarmouth Natural Heritage Area consists of 208 acres of forest, ponds, wetlands and streams. In efforts to return the Area to its natural state, CCCA prohibits vehicles from entering the property. A Management Plan provides for new walking trails and a Butterfly Habitat.

(December 27, 2018, 3:31 pm) This is a true gem of a hiking trail. Well marked with most trails running along the clear waters of Catfish Creek or around large wetland ponds. Many new trees have been planted to supplement the great variety of old growth trees that make up the tall canopy.

Catfish Creek is a beautiful and well-maintained loop around wetland, truly a gem for birders and naturalists alike. Trailhead right off Sparta line has a good amount of parking spots. The route follows the creek all the way to the pond. It forms a loop between the two water features, making it a great way to explore the heritage area. Reviews.

What is Yarmouth Natural Heritage Area? Yarmouth Natural Heritage Area is maintained by Catfish Creek Conservation Authority, a local non-profit seeking to conserve and restore the beautiful natural habitats that are vital for this land and for the diverse species that exist here.
